The Importance of Portfolio Diversification in Trading Options: Portfolio diversification is a well-known strategy used by traders to minimize risk and maximize returns. By spreading investments across multiple assets and sectors, diversification helps safeguard against volatility and reduces the dependence on a single investment. In trading options, portfolio diversification involves selecting a mix of options contracts with varying strike prices, expiration dates, and underlying assets. The goal is to create a well-balanced portfolio that can generate consistent profits while mitigating potential losses. 2. The Role of Test Automation in Portfolio Diversification Trading Options: Test automation refers to the use of software tools and frameworks to automate the testing and validation of trading options strategies. By automating repetitive tasks, such as data retrieval, analysis, and backtesting, traders can streamline their decision-making process, free up valuable time, and reduce the possibility of human error. Here are some key ways in which test automation can enhance portfolio diversification in trading options: a. Efficient Strategy Backtesting: Test automation allows traders to quickly and accurately backtest their portfolio diversification strategies on historical market data. By simulating various market conditions and testing different combinations of options contracts, traders can gain valuable insights into the profitability and risk of their strategies. This helps in fine-tuning the portfolio composition and identifying potential weaknesses before implementing the strategies in live trading. b. Real-Time Data Monitoring: Keeping track of real-time market data is crucial for making informed trading decisions. Test automation tools can continuously monitor market feeds, retrieve relevant data, and provide traders with up-to-date information. This enables traders to react swiftly to changing market dynamics and adjust their portfolio diversification strategies accordingly. c. Risk Management and Compliance: Portfolio diversification strategies must adhere to risk management guidelines and regulatory compliance. Test automation can ensure that the predetermined risk thresholds and compliance rules are met. By automating risk assessment and compliance checks, traders can avoid violations and maintain regulatory compliance, reducing the potential for penalties or reputational damage. d. Scalability and Reproducibility: As traders expand their portfolio diversification options, managing and reproducing strategies can become complex and time-consuming. Test automation tools offer scalability by automating the process of replicating and executing strategies across multiple assets, saving traders significant effort and resources. Additionally, automated reporting capabilities allow traders to easily analyze and compare the performance of different diversification strategies. 3.
